Cairn circle at the Southern end of the Upper Erme Stone Row on Dartmoor, which is the longest stone row in the world. It measures 3386 metres, starting at a small cairn on Green Hill, crossing the River Erme and finishing on Stall Moor. #TombTuesday taken in March 2004.

Keilnascarta standing stones, West Cork. A Three stone row and two stone pairs, in adjacent fields c 150 apart in a NNW/SSE line. The rows are aligned roughly NE/SW. The most SE pair have been incorporated into a modern field boundary . Taken in March 2012 #StandingStoneSunday 2
